Let us now understand the definition, causes, signs and symptoms, diagnosis and treatment of hypoglycaemia. It is very important for you to learn about it because patient will be having hypoglycaemia due to various reasons and immediate care should be provided and patient should also be aware of signs and symptoms.
Hypoglycaemia is defined as state of low blood glucose level of less than 50mg/dl. Low blood sugar level varies from person to person.
